Introduction THE CORE is an all-round acting arts course that draws upon different performing arts elements to fast-track students wanting to start their career or be ready to audition for advanced acting courses. The course draws upon exercises by many of the great acting teachers: Stanislavski, Sanford Meisner, Stella Adler, Lee Strasberg, Michael Chekhov, Grotowski and the Eric Morris complete acting system. These, combined with voice and movement training, help students to develop better spatial and sensory awareness and break down blocks and inhibitions. The students will develop techniques and personal confidence that enable them to reach a connected being state, which is essential for the delivery of honest and moving performances on stage and screen. Quality Assurance ACTT has been in operation since 1992 and is a Registered Training Organisation (RTO) that satisfies the national standards of the Australian Quality Training Framework (AQTF). All full time courses are listed on CRICOS and available to overseas students. The courses are accredited by ASQA, and the technical qualifications are drawn from the National Entertainment Training Package. ACTT is a member of the Australian Council for Private Education and Training (ACPET), the peak industry association for independent providers of education.
